GrammarJLPT N1
after (a long process)
AdverbNoun

Definitions

  1. 1. after (a long process)
  2. 2. at the end of
  3. 3. last line (of a renga)
Used to express "in the end" or "after all that," often implying that a long or troublesome process led to an unsatisfying or unfortunate result. It typically carries a negative or exasperated tone and follows descriptions of prolonged effort or struggle.
